Atelier Merano 2017

The Atelier was hosted by Meraner Musikwochen / Settimane Musicali Meranesi in collaboration with Italiafestival. 22 participants from 14 different countries and all continents took part for the 7-day training programme during which they discussed various aspects of festival management with 8 renowned festival managers from pioneering festivals and outstanding art centres and institutes from all over the world.

Under the coordination of Hugo De Greef, leading and experienced festival operators, professionals and artists from all over the world, guided the participants through the seven days. Mentors and presenters, pioneering festival managers, gave lectures, lead workshops and took part in round tables and debates – all of them have spent several days with the participants allowing face-to-face contacts and discussions.

The following festival directors participated in the Atelier Merano 2017:

  • Bernard Faivre D’Arcier, President Lyon Biennial, former longstanding Director Avignon Festival – France
  • Rose Fenton, Director Free Word, co-founder of The Festival Academy  – UK
  • Nele Hertling, Member Strategy Group “A Soul for Europe”, Former Vice-President of the Academy of Arts Berlin, Former Director Hebbel-Theater Berlin – Germany)
  • Marta Keil, Curator, dramaturg and researcher – Poland
  • Gundega Laivina, Director New Theatre Institute of Latvia, Artistic & Managing Director of Homo Novus, former member artistic board of Riga – European Cultural Capital 2014 – Latvia
  • Michał Merczyński, Director Malta Festival Poznań and Nostalgia Festival Poznań –  Poland
  • Roberto Naccari (General Manager Santarcangelo Festival – Italy).
